What does an assistant video game project manager do?

An Assistant Video Game Project Manager supports the lead project manager in planning, organizing, and overseeing the development process of a video game. Their tasks often include coordinating between different departments, tracking project timelines, managing schedules, and ensuring milestones are met. They also help with documentation, communication, and problem-solving to keep the project on track. This role is essential for ensuring that the game development process runs smoothly and ef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ant video game project man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Video Game Project Manager, you need a solid understanding of project management principles, familiarity with the game development process, and often a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Proficiency with project management software such as Jira, Trello, or Asana, and knowledge of version control systems like Git are typically required. Strong organizational skills, effective communication, and the ability to collaborate across multidisciplinary teams set top candidates apart. These skills ensure projects stay on track, meet deadlines, and enable effective coordination between creative and technical teams in a dynamic industry.

How does an assistant video game project manager typically collaborate with development teams during a game's production cycle?

Assistant Video Game Project Managers play a key role in facilitating communication between different departments, such as design, programming, and art. They often help organize meetings, track progress on deliverables, and ensure that everyone has the resources and information needed to meet milestones. By coordinating schedules and addressing potential bottlenecks early, they support the Lead Project Manager in keeping the project on track. This role requires flexibility and strong organizational skills, as priorities can shift quickly during game development.

Role Summary
Rowan Digital Infrastructure is looking for an APM (Assistant Project Manager) to support the successful planning and execution of data center development and construction projects across Rowan Digital Infrastructure's growing portfolio.
The successful candidate will work closely with Project Managers and cross-functional partners. The APM will assist with project coordination, reporting, schedule tracking, and issue resolution to help ensure projects are delivered safely, on time, within budget, and to quality standards. This role is ideal for a highly organized, detail-oriented professional who is eager to build a strong foundation in large-scale infrastructure project delivery while contributing to a fast-paced, collaborative environment.
Travel: Ability to travel up to 25% for company gatherings or to project sites.
Location: Denver, Colorado/Hybrid
Compensation: $90k - $105k (Offers Bonus)
Essential Responsibilities
  • Support Project Managers in the day-to-day coordination and execution of data center development and construction projects
  • Assist with maintaining project schedules, budgets, risk registers, and action item logs
  • Track project milestones, deliverables, and key dependencies; escalate risks and issues as appropriate
  • Prepare and maintain project documentation, reports, and dashboards for internal and external stakeholders
  • Coordinate meetings, agendas, and follow-ups with internal teams, consultants, contractors, and vendors
  • Support procurement activities, including tracking contracts, change orders, and invoices
  • Assist with document control, ensuring drawings, specifications, and project records are current and organized
  • Help monitor compliance with safety, quality, and regulatory requirements
  • Support site activities as needed, including occasional travel to active project sites
  • Contribute to continuous improvement of project management processes, tools, and reporting standards

Education, Skills, and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in construction management, Engineering, Architecture, Business, or a related field.
  • 1-3 years of experience supporting projects in construction, infrastructure, real estate development, or a related industry
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, PowerPoint); experience with document control and project management software is a plus (Procore, P6)
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to work collaboratively across diverse teams and stakeholders
  • Detail-oriented with strong follow-through and problem-solving skills
  • Willingness to learn and grow into increased responsibility over time
  • Familiarity with data center, mission-critical, or large-scale commercial construction projects is a plus but not required
